Spurgeon continued to edit the Sword and Trowel up through 1891. He was in poor health for most of that year, but continued to write a few articles and the prefatory essay to the year-end volume. He died at the beginning of 1892. The Spurgeon Center at Midwestern Seminary has digitized all of the issues through 1892 and they are available at
